Está en la página 1de 8

¿Qué es MongoDB?

Es una base de satos distribuida NoSQL, orientados


a código abierto y documentos .

MondoDB guarda estructuras con un esquema


dinámico, haciendo que la integración de los datos
en algunas aplicaciones se fácil y rápida
Historia de MongoDB
MongoDB fue fundada en 2007 por Dwight
Merriman, Eliot Horowitz y Kevin Ryan, el equipo
detrás de DoubleClick.

En la empresa de publicidad en Internet DoubleClick


(ahora propiedad de Google), el equipo desarrolló y
utilizó numerosos almacenes de datos personalizados
para solucionar las carencias de las bases de datos
existentes. El negocio servía 400 000 anuncios por
segundo, pero a menudo tenía problemas de
escalabilidad y agilidad. Frustrado, el equipo halló
inspiración para crear una base de datos que abordara
los desafíos a los que se enfrentaban en DoubleClick.
Características de MongoDB

Consultas Índices Reconocer Encontrar Ejecuta Concepto de


Consultas Adhoc

Funciones Map/Reduce

Balance de carga
Indexación

Análisis de rendimiento

Replicación
de rangos secundarios posibles documentos comando de shard
defectos con x lectura y
requisitos escritura
Desventajas de MongoDB

No es suficiente para
algunas empresas

Muy poca
experiencia en el
mercado
Dificultades en
compatibilidad
Ventajas de MongoDB

Velocidad de Escalamiento
Consultas Sencillo
Utiliza
memoria en
vez de disco
duro

Nube con
Código
ajuste
abierto
diferente
Lenguajes de MongoDB
Referencias

• MongoDB.
(s. f.). https://es.slideshare.net/rufinorojasmartinez/
mongodb-52724717
• MongoDB. (s. f.-a). Acerca de nosotros - nuestra
historia |
MongoDB. https://www.mongodb.com/es/company

También podría gustarte